微信小程序开发全攻略

Tandou8883个月前网站开发88

青衣网络:微信小程序开发全攻略 目录: 1. 小程序概述 2. 开发环境搭建 3. 小程序框架和语言选择 4. 界面设计与实现 5. 功能开发与调试 6. 发布与运维

正文:

1. 小程序概述

微信小程序是一种无需下载安装即可使用的应用,用户通过扫一扫或搜索就能打开应用。它实现了“用完即走”的理念,极大地方便了用户的使用。小程序的应用场景非常广泛,包括电商、游戏、工具、服务等各个领域。

2. 开发环境搭建

在开始微信小程序开发之前,需要先搭建开发环境。这包括安装微信开发者工具、配置开发环境、申请开发者账号等步骤。微信开发者工具是官方提供的集成开发环境,支持代码编辑、调试、预览等功能,是开发微信小程序的必备工具。

3. 小程序框架和语言选择

微信小程序提供了一套完整的开发框架,包括视图层(WXML)、逻辑层(JS)和样式层(WXSS)。开发者可以根据项目需求选择合适的开发语言和框架。同时,微信小程序还支持插件化开发,可以方便地引入第三方库和组件,提高开发效率。

4. 界面设计与实现

微信小程序的界面设计应遵循简洁明了的原则,注重用户体验。在实现过程中,可以使用微信小程序提供的组件和API进行布局和交互设计。同时,还可以利用第三方UI库和组件来丰富界面效果,提升用户体验。

5. 功能开发与调试

微信小程序的功能开发主要包括数据绑定、事件处理、网络请求等方面。开发者可以通过编写JavaScript代码来实现这些功能。在开发过程中,可以使用微信开发者工具提供的调试功能进行代码调试,确保程序的正确性和稳定性。

6. 发布与运维

完成小程序的开发后,需要进行测试和优化,确保程序的质量和性能。然后可以将小程序提交给微信官方审核,审核通过后即可发布上线。在运维过程中,需要定期更新和维护小程序,修复漏洞和问题,保持程序的稳定性和安全性。

问:微信小程序的开发环境如何搭建? 答:微信小程序的开发环境搭建主要包括安装微信开发者工具、配置开发环境、申请开发者账号等步骤。首先,需要从官方网站下载并安装微信开发者工具;然后,根据开发文档配置开发环境,包括设置项目路径、端口号等;最后,申请开发者账号并登录微信开发者工具,即可开始开发微信小程序。

问:微信小程序的界面设计应注意哪些原则? 答:微信小程序的界面设计应遵循简洁明了的原则,注重用户体验。具体来说,应避免过多的动画和复杂的布局,保持页面的简洁和清晰;同时,要合理使用颜色和字体,提高可读性和辨识度;此外,还要考虑不同屏幕尺寸和分辨率的适配问题,确保在各种设备上都能正常显示和使用。

免费建站请关注:www.ra0.cn

相关文章

网站开发的艺术:构建用户和搜索引擎友好的平台

标题:网站开发的艺术:构建用户和搜索引擎友好的平台 目录: 1. 网站开发的基础 - 网站开发的技术要素 - 用户体验(UX)设计的重要性 2. 内容管理系统(CMS)的选择 -...

深度解析SEO策略:提升在线可见性与搜索引擎排名

标题:深度解析SEO策略:提升在线可见性与搜索引擎排名 目录: 1. SEO的定义与重要性 2. 关键词研究的艺术 3. 内容优化的核心原则 4. 技术SEO的角色与影响 5. 链接建设的策略分析...

深入解析SEO:提升网站能见度的艺术

标题:深入解析SEO:提升网站能见度的艺术 目录: 1. 理解SEO的重要性 2. 关键词研究与应用 3. 优化网站结构 4. 内容创造与优化 5. 链接建设策略 6. 移动优先索引的影响 7. 社交...

微信小程序开发:打造高效应用的秘诀

标题:微信小程序开发:打造高效应用的秘诀 目录: 1. 微信小程序简介 2. 开发环境搭建 3. 界面设计基础 4. 逻辑处理与数据交互 5. 性能优化策略 6. 调试与测试流程 7. 发布与维护指...

网站维护的艺术:保障稳定运行与提升用户体验

标题:网站维护的艺术:保障稳定运行与提升用户体验 目录: 1. 网站维护的重要性 2. 定期更新与备份策略 3. 安全性检查与防护措施 4. 优化加载速度与性能 5. 用户支持与反馈机制 6. 移动...

网站维护的重要性与实践策略

标题:网站维护的重要性与实践策略 目录: 1. 网站维护的基本概念 2. 网站维护的重要性 3. 常见的网站维护任务 4. 网站维护的策略和技巧 5. 网站维护的挑战及解决方案 6. 未来趋势:网站...